Just tested capturing USB ports to a VM based on this guide it works. Using this and a USB hub to turn 1 port into X, and it's all a VM needs for plug-n-play tech. If anyone cares for my crib-notes: Run following commands in command line: lsusb lspci | grep USB readlink /sys/bus/usb/devices/usb* Excerpt from “11b” solution from forum: You then have to modify some parts of it to get it to work. The good thing is that you do not have to care about which bus and address it's suppos